X
Lost password?

Don't have an account?
Gain Access Now

X

Receive free daily analysis

NFL
NBA
NHL
NASCAR
CFB
MLB
MMA
PGA
ESPORTS
BETTING

Already have an account? Log In

X

Forgot Password


POPULAR FANTASY TOOLS

Expert Advice
Articles & Tools
Import Your Leagues
Daily Stats & Leaders
All Pitcher Matchups
Compare Any Players
Compare Any Players
Rookies & Call-Ups
24x7 News and Alerts

MLB DFS Picks Today: Daily Fantasy Baseball Strategy and Tips For FanDuel, DraftKings (5/31/25)

Kodai Senga - Fantasy Baseball Rankings, Draft Sleepers, MLB Injury News

Koby's top DraftKings and FanDuel MLB DFS picks for today, Saturday, 5/31/25. His favorite daily fantasy baseball lineup sleepers and value picks for DFS on DraftKings and FanDuel.

Welcome Back, RotoBallers! We have a solid nine-game slate, and the weather is looking solid in all the games. The Phillies game and the Mets game have a small chance of seeing some rain, but in the end, we should be okay.

This article will provide my daily fantasy baseball lineup picks for DraftKings and FanDuel on 5/31/2025. I'll focus my picks on the main slate starting at 4:05 p.m. EDT on both sites. The lineup picks will showcase elite players, mid-priced options, and value plays.

You can also read more DFS advice and lineup picks for other sports here. Monitoring injury news and today's MLB starting lineups is always essential.

Featured Promo: Get any Props Premium Pass for 30% off using code NEW. Win more with our two new Props Optimizer tools -- one for PrizePicks Props, and one for Sportsbook Betting Props. Find optimal prop bets and get our recommended picks daily! Go Premium, Win More!

 

DraftKings, FanDuel Pitchers - MLB DFS Lineup Picks

It's a loaded pitching slate, so there are certainly more than just these five arms as viable options, but here are some of my favorites.

Sonny Gray - STL at TEX ($8K DK; $9.5K FD) 

The Texas Rangers' offense has just fallen apart this month. They are the worst team in the MLB across the last two weeks regarding wRC+ at 67 against RHP. They have a poor team ISO of .115, which means they have very little power against righties. Sonny Gray has had a couple of solid outings recently, going 6+ innings in three of his last four starts while allowing only three runs in that time.

The Phillies blew him up for seven runs, but with the recent play of the Rangers, I don't see Gray having that issue with them. Sonny Gray has a solid 26% K% this season to go with a low 5.1% BB%.

Kodai Senga - NYM vs. COL ($8.9K DK; $10.2K FD)

Kodai Senga has flown under the radar a bit this season. He has been great at avoiding giving up runs; his biggest downfall, however, has been the walks. If he can keep those low, Senga should have no issue going far into this game and picking up the win, which he has done five times this season. He has an impressive 1.46 ERA on the season and has only given up two runs at home this season.

They are getting the struggling Rockies as well, who have a wRC+ of 77 across the last two weeks of RHP. The Rockies also have a 28% strikeout rate. This is a home-run spot for Kodai as long as he keeps the walks low. He should cruise through Colorado.

Robbie Ray - SFG at MIA ($9K DK; $10.6K FD) 

Robbie has been dynamite this season. He is one of the best LHP in the league this season, only behind a couple of big names in Max Fried and Tarik Skubal. Robbie's last six starts are what I want to focus on, as he has 7+ strikeouts in all but one of those games and has a quality start in all six games!

The Marlins were only able to muster up three hits in last night's game against the Giants, and their hitting against LHP has them below average in most metrics across the last few weeks. I see a lot of people going towards Kodai as their cash game pitcher, but I think Robbie Ray could be one of the best options on the slate.

Also Consider: Michael Wacha - KCR vs. DET ($6.8K DK; $8.4K FD), Kyle Hendricks - LAA at CLE ($7.4K DK; $6.9K FD)

 

Want more MLB DFS tools and content? Our MLB Premium package includes our daily DFS Cheat Sheets, Research Station, Lineup Optimizer, and access to our Premium Discord Chatrooms, where members can chat with our MLB analysts. Win more with expert tools and advice from proven winners!

 

DraftKings, FanDuel Infielders - MLB DFS Lineup Picks

Ryan O'Hearn, 1B/OF - BAL vs. Davis Martin ($4.4K DK; $3K FD) 

I'm surprised to see him as cheap as he is. Ryan O'Hearn is red-hot right now; he has 17 hits in his last eight games, with two of those being home runs. He also gets to go against a RHP, and although Davis Martin has been solid against LHH this season. O'Hearn has a .472 wOBA and .649 SLG against RHP so far this season.

He has been one of the best hitters for this poor Orioles team, but makes for an elite one-off or part of a small stack.

Brett Baty, 3B/2B - NYM vs. Antonio Senzatela ($3.1K DK; $2.7K FD)

Brett Baty has been great against RHP and extremely good at home this season. This is a recipe for a big game for him. Senzatela has been terrible this season with an over 6.50 ERA, and he has been crushed by LHH this season.

Senzatela has a .421 wOBA against LHHs and 46.3% HardHit%. This is a great spot for Baty, who is relatively cheap compared to his bigger-name counterparts such as Francisco Lindor and Pete Alonso.

Danny Jansen, C - TBR vs. Colton Gordon ($2.5K DK; $2.5K FD) 

The people who make the prices don't know about Jansen vs LHP this season. He has been incredibly efficient against them as he has a .415 wOBA and a wRC+ of 178 this season. He also has an absurd 26% BB% against Lefties. Gordon hasn't been anything special this season for the Astros, and I don't expect that to change anytime soon. Jansen is dirt cheap and is a perfect Rays stack option.

Also Consider: Francisco Lindor - SS ($5.6K DK; $4K FD), Junior Caminero - 3B ($4.3K DK; $3.1K FD), Ivan Herrera - C ($5.4K DK; $3.1K FD)

 

DraftKings, FanDuel Outfielders - MLB DFS Lineup Picks

Brendan Donovan, 3B/SS(FD) 2B/OF - STL vs. Patrick Corbin ($5K DK; $3.1K FD) 

Patrick Corbin came back down to earth after a decent start to the season. He has three straight games of three runs allowed, and STL has been hitting the ball much better. The super-utility in Brendan Donovan has been specifically hitting the ball extremely well. He has nine hits in the last five games.

Corbin has given up a .375 wOBA and .537 SLG against LHH. Donovan has a .304 wOBA and .412 SLG against LHP, which is the third-best on the team.

Brandon Nimmo, OF - NYM vs. Antonio Senzatela ($3.8K DK; $2.8K FD) 

A lot of people will gravitate towards Juan Soto for the same reason you should go to Nimmo for cheaper. Soto brings more power but has been much worse recently. Nimmo has as many hits in four games as Soto has in his last ten games. LHH has done extremely well against Senztaela as I mentioned earlier with Baty. Nimmo makes for an elite pairing alongside Baty in your Mets stacks!

Michael Harris II, OF - ATL vs. Walker Buehler ($3.6K DK; $2.5K FD) 

Michael Harris isn't quite having the season he would like to have, but he does have nine hits in as many games. Walker Buehler has been great against RHH, but not great against LHH. This makes Harris an interesting option, especially at his price. LHH has a .361 wOBA and .424 SLG against Buehler this season.

Harris hasn't quite had the power, but he has been able to get on base, and just like in "Moneyball", that's what matters most!

Also Consider: Jarren Duran - OF ($5.2K DK; $3.7K FD), Kyle Schwarber - OF ($5.7K DK; $4.2K FD), Josh Lowe - OF ($5K DK; $3.3K FD)

 

DraftKings, FanDuel MLB DFS Stacks

New York Mets (5.5 implied run total) vs. Antonio Senzatela (COL)

The Mets have been a bit lackluster against RHP across the last two weeks, but this is the perfect bounce-back spot for them. Senzatela has been awful this season, and the Mets should have no issue exploiting that at home with one of the best-implied run totals on the slate.

Tampa Bay Rays (4.3 implied run total) vs. Colton Gordon (HOU)

The Rays have been sneaky good against LHP across the last two weeks with a combined wRC+ of 159. The only team better in that span against LHP is the Astros. Gordon hasn't been great in three starts, giving up three runs in all of those games and at least five hits.

Baltimore Orioles (5.3 implied run total) vs. Davis Martin (CHW)

Davis Martin has been serviceable for the White Sox, but if the LHH in the lineup can get to Martin early. They could get him out of there and get to the bullpen, which hasn't been great this season.



Download Our Free News & Alerts Mobile App

Like what you see? Download our updated fantasy baseball app for iPhone and Android with 24x7 player news, injury alerts, sleepers, prospects & more. All free!



More Fantasy Baseball Analysis




POPULAR FANTASY TOOLS

Expert Advice
Articles & Tools
Import Your Leagues
Daily Stats & Leaders
All Pitcher Matchups
Compare Any Players
Compare Any Players
Rookies & Call-Ups
24x7 News and Alerts
RANKINGS
C
1B
2B
3B
SS
OF
SP
RP

RANKINGS

QB
RB
WR
TE
K
DEF

REAL-TIME FANTASY NEWS

Riley Herbst

a Punt Play at Nashville
Aaron Judge

Goes Deep Twice in Loss
Max Muncy

Homers Twice in Win
Jacob Melton

Called up to Big League Roster
Tyler Reddick

a Strong DFS Contender on Paper, but He'll Likely Run Worse Than Expected
Joey Logano

Team Will Likely Ignore Nashville After He Locked Into the Playoffs
Kyle Busch

Loss of Intermediate Speed This Year Will Likely Foil Him at Nashville
Chris Buescher

Despite Improved Qualifying Speed, Chris Buescher Seems Much Slower in Races
Austin Cindric

Team Penske's Firing of Austin Cindric's Dad May Hurt the No. 2 Team's Morale
Ryan Preece

an Underrated DFS Option Given His Impressive Passing This Year
Noah Gragson

Passing Will Likely Prove to Difficult for Noah Gragson to Have DFS Value
Michael McDowell

Qualified Too Well for DFS Consideration
Erik Jones

Probably Starting too Well for Place Differential Points but Not Well Enough for Other Bonus Points
Corey Heim

Unlikely to Match 23XI Racing Teammates' Speed at Nashville
Cole Custer

Likely Needs Strategy Shakeup to Have DFS Value at Nashville
Ty Dillon

Likely Needs Another Chaotic Nashville Race to Contend
Adolis García

Adolis Garcia Could Continue to Rest
Zack Littell

Throws Complete Game
Junior Caminero

Homers Twice in Win
Tony Bradley

Available Saturday
A.J. Greer

Questionable for Start of Stanley Cup Finals
Roope Hintz

Dealing with Fractured Foot
Sean Walker

Nursing a Shoulder Injury
Daulton Varsho

Exits Early on Saturday
Jalen Chatfield

Recovering From Hip Injury
Seth Jarvis

to Delay Shoulder Surgery
Adam Boqvist

Agrees to One-Year Extension with Islanders
Kyle Palmieri

Signs Two-Year Extension with Islanders
Xavier Edwards

Reinstated from 10-Day Injured List
Yordan Alvarez

has Hand Fracture, Set to Return in Near Future
David Fry

Returns from 60-Day Injured List
Matt Wallner

Activated from Injured List
Justin Fields

has Faith in Himself
Keston Hiura

Michael Toglia Optioned, Keston Hiura Recalled
Shay Whitcomb

Promoted to Major Leagues
Quinshon Judkins

to Work With Starters Sooner Than Later
Dawand Jones

Takes Part in OTAs
Ryan Mountcastle

Orioles Place Ryan Mountcastle on 10-Day Injured List With Hamstring Strain
Freddie Freeman

Aggravates his Ankle
Mookie Betts

has Fractured Toe, to Miss Rest of Series Against Yankees
Cole Young

Mariners to Promote Cole Young to Major Leagues
Willi Castro

Goes Deep Twice
Shohei Ohtani

Crushes Pair of Homers
Cal Raleigh

Smacks Two More Homers on Friday
Marcus Semien

Swipes Bag, Homers Amidst Four-Hit Effort
Shedeur Sanders

Last in Line in QB Competition
Joe Flacco

the Favorite for Starting QB Job
Tony Bradley

Questionable For Saturday Night
Karl-Anthony Towns

Not on the Injury Report for Game 6
Joe Mixon

Currently in Walking Boot
C.J. Stroud

Dealing with Minor Injury
Dillon Gabriel

Unlikely to Win Starting Gig
Bryce Huff

49ers Nearing Trade for Bryce Huff
Seattle Seahawks

Anthony Campbell Signs with Seattle
Baltimore Ravens

Ravens Sign Malaki Starks
Audric Estime

in Line for More Touches
Jaxson Dart

Signs Rookie Contract
Erin Blanchfield

A Favorite At UFC Vegas 107
Maycee Barber

Looks To Extend Her Win Streak
Ludovit Klein

Set For UFC Vegas 107 Co-Main Event
Mateusz Gamrot

Returns At UFC Vegas 107
Billy Ray Goff

Looks For His Second UFC Win
Ramiz Brahimaj

An Underdog At UFC Vegas 107
Dustin Jacoby

Looks To Win Back-To-Back Fights
Bruno Lopes

Set For His Second UFC Bout
Ketlen Vieira

Looks To Get Back In The Win Column
Macy Chiasson

Looks For Third Consecutive Win
Duško Todorović

Dusko Todorovic In Dire Need Of Victory
Zachary Reese

Set To Open Up UFC Vegas 107 Main Card
Minnesota Vikings

Vikings Sign Kwesi Adofo-Mensah to Multi-Year Extension
Isaiah Likely

John Harbaugh Wants to See Isaiah Likely Become an All-Pro
Jameson Williams

Lions Expecting Big Season From Jameson Williams
Brandon Aiyuk

49ers Optimistic About Brandon Aiyuk's Recovery
Jakobi Meyers

Other Receivers Being Moved Around a Lot
Christian Wilkins

Malcolm Koonce Returns to Practice, Christian Wilkins Still Out
Geno Smith

Things Going Smoothly With Geno Smith, Chip Kelly
Travis Kelce

Patrick Mahomes Says Travis Kelce is Locked In
Wyatt Johnston

Finishes Thursday's Loss with Two Assists
Jason Robertson

Pots Two Goals in Season-Ending Defeat
Stuart Skinner

Picks Up Fourth Consecutive Win
Mattias Ekholm

Collects an Assist in Postseason Debut
Leon Draisaitl

Delivers Two Assists in Series-Clinching Win
Connor McDavid

Extends Multi-Point Streak in Series-Clincher
Karl-Anthony Towns

Cleared to Play Thursday
Aaron Nesmith

Available Thursday
Shakir Mukhamadullin

Inks One-Year Extension with Sharks
Tyson Foerster

Signs Two-Year Extension with Flyers
NHL

Jonathan Toews Eyeing NHL Comeback
Bo Horvat

Out 4-6 Weeks with Ankle Injury
Jeff Skinner

Back in Oilers Lineup Thursday
Mattias Ekholm

Returns to Action Thursday
Julius Randle

Notches Team-High 24 Points in Blowout Loss
Anthony Edwards

Struggles in Game 5 Loss
Jalen Williams

Remains Busy Wednesday
Chet Holmgren

Strong at Both Ends Wednesday
Shai Gilgeous-Alexander

Records Another 30-Point Performance
Brandin Podziemski

Recovering From Wrist Surgery
Connor Brown

to Miss Second Consecutive Game
Seth Jarvis

Notches Two Points in Wednesday's Loss
Aaron Nesmith

Back on the Injury Report Ahead of Game 5
Karl-Anthony Towns

Listed as Questionable for Thursday's Game 5
PGA

Byeong Hun An Is a Shaky Play at Muirfield
Christiaan Bezuidenhout

a Decent Play at Muirfield
Brian Harman

May Not Be a Good Option at Muirfield
Matt Fitzpatrick

Has Great History at Memorial
Denny McCarthy

A Solid Choice At Muirfield Village
Tony Finau

Shaping Into Form Heading Into Memorial
Cameron Young

Hard to Trust at the Memorial
PGA

Alex Noren a Sneaky Value Play at the Memorial
Patrick Cantlay

Has Potential Heading Into Muirfield
Sepp Straka

Eyeing Another Elite Signature-Event Performance
Wyndham Clark

Not A Reliable Option Ahead Of Memorial
Aaron Rai

Looking to Bounce Back at the Memorial
Max Homa

Still in Fantasy Golf Purgatory at Memorial Tournament
Viktor Hovland

Rounding into Form Ahead of the Memorial
Stephan Jaeger

is a Scary Play at Muirfield Village
PGA

Sungjae Im a Volatile Option at the Memorial
Jordan Spieth

Looks to Turn the Corner at Muirfield Village
Xander Schauffele

a Strong Contender at Muirfield Village
Robert MacIntyre

Making Muirfield Village Debut
Michael Kim

Slide Continues Heading into Colonial
Josh Hart

Logs a Double-Double Off the Bench Tuesday
Karl-Anthony Towns

Collects Another Double-Double in Tuesday's Loss
Sam Burns

Playing Well as the Memorial Approaches
Jalen Brunson

Leads Knicks with 31 Points in Tuesday's Loss
Pascal Siakam

Drops 30 Points on Knicks in Game 4 Win
Tyrese Haliburton

Records Historic Triple-Double Tuesday
Russell Westbrook

Undergoes Hand Surgery
Brad Keselowski

Finally Gets a Good Finish in 2025
William Byron

Dominant Charlotte Performance Falls Short At the End
Tyler Reddick

Strong Coca-Cola 600 Run Ruined By A Late Pit-Road Penalty
Denny Hamlin

Is Relegated to 16th Place At Charlotte Despite Strong Car
Kyle Larson

Coca-Cola 600 Performance Crashes Down In Disappointment
Nickeil Alexander-Walker

Leads Timberwolves in Scoring Monday
Jaden McDaniels

Busy Against Thunder in Game 4
Christopher Bell

Disappoints by his High Standards But Gains on Points Lead
Chase Elliott

has Another Invisible Race but Still Improves Playoff Position
AJ Allmendinger

A.J. Allmendinger Earns Highest Oval Driver Rating Since 2011 at Charlotte